L'Hôtel du libre échange is a comedy written by the French playwrights Georges Feydeau and Maurice Desvallières in 1894. The play takes place in Paris in the 19th century and follows two Parisian households and their friends over the course of two days. The play has three acts: Acts One and Three take place in Monsieur Pinglet's office, while Act Two takes place in Hôtel du Libre Échange, a small Parisian hotel. The play has been translated into several other languages.
